OVERVIEW

The Family Learning Center is a 501(c)(3) tax-exempt not-for-profit organization, located in Boulder, Colorado. We are a comprehensive human services agency that annually provides thousands of low-income children and families with programs and skills training in youth and family development, education, health and wellness, and community development.

Established in 1981 by community organizer Brenda Lyle, local advocates and parents, The Family Learning Center began as an early childhood co-op for 43 low-income preschool children and their families. Today it has grown to become a full-service human services agency, serving more than 2,000 children and families a year, supported by a volunteer Board of Directors, over 18 staff and more than 200 volunteers.

For 28 years, The Family Learning Center has provided low income and culturally diverse children and families with meaningful opportunities to become educated, productive members of the community who can successfully compete in a global society.
